ORDER
The petitioner has filed this Tr.C.M.P. to withdraw the proceedings pending before the Sub-Court, Thiruvarur in H.M.O.P.No.69 of 2015 and transfer the same to the Family Court, Chennai.
2. It is the case of the petitioner-wife that owing to harassment at the hands of the respondent-husband, earlier, she filed a complaint before the All Women Police Station, Thiruvaur, in which, enquiry was conducted, based upon which, the respondent-husband agreed to live together. Thereafter, the respondent-husband filed H.M.O.P.No.69 of 2015 before the Sub-Court, Thiruvarur, for restitution of conjugal rights. It is further stated that the petitioner is now residing in her parents' house. It is her grievance that it is impossible for her to attend the hearing of the case in Thiruvarur and that she is unable to spend for travel from Chennai to Thiruvarur. It is further stated by the petitioner that she is unable to leave her son in Chennai, whenever she has to appear for hearing of the case before the Sub-Court at Thiruvarur. 3. Though the respondent had been served with notice and his name having been printed in the cause list, there is no representation for the respondent, either in person or through counsel.
4. Taking into consideration the facts and circumstances of the case and the grievances of the petitioner, this Court finds that the petitioner is entitled for transfer of the case from Thiruvarur to Chennai. Accordingly, this Tr.C.M.P. is allowed and H.M.O.P.No.69 of 2015 pending on the file of the Sub-Court, Thiruvarur, shall stand transferred to the file of the Principal Judge, Family Court, Chennai.
